Nurse Practitioner Salary in Clarksville, TN: $119,133 (2026)
Quick Answer:A full-time nurse practitioner in Clarksville, TN earns a median $119,133/year (≈ $57.28/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 29-1171). Once you factor in Clarksville's price level (9% below national, BEA RPP 90.9), that paycheck buys what $130,992 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 2.4% above the Tennessee state average.

In 2026, nurse practitioners in Clarksville, TN, can expect a median annual salary of $119,133, a figure that reflects their significant contributions in a state where full-practice authority allows for independent practice. The salary range varies considerably, from $98,991 at the lowest end to $153,872 at the top, based on data derived from the official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) surveys. Despite these promising numbers locally, the median salary in Clarksville lags approximately 12.96% behind the national average of $136,864. Salary Breakdown
| Percentile | Annual | Hourly |
|---|---|---|
| Entry Level (P10) | $98,991 | $47.59 |
| Lower Range (P25) | $102,002 | $49.04 |
| Median (P50)(typical) | $119,133 | $57.28 |
| Upper Range (P75) | $132,333 | $63.62 |
| Top Earners (P90) | $153,872 | $73.98 |

How Clarksville Nurse Practitioner Pay Compares
Clarksville median: $119,133/year (2026)
| Compared To | Median Salary | Clarksville Pays |
|---|---|---|
| Tennessee Average | $116,341 | +2.40% more |
| National Average | $136,864 | -12.96% less |
Nurse Practitioners in Clarksville, TN earn a median of $119,133 per year (2026 est.), which is 12.96% lower than the national median of $136,864 and 2.40% above the Tennessee state average of $116,341.
Cost-of-Living Adjusted Salary
Clarksville has a cost of living 9.05% below the national average, meaning your salary goes further here.
Adjusted salary = nominal × (100 / CoL index). CoL index: 100 = national average.
Clarksville, TN has a cost-of-living index of 90.947 (below the national average of 100). A nurse practitioner earning $119,133 nominally has purchasing power equivalent to $130,992 in an average-cost city — an effective 9.95% boost.

Salary Trajectory for Nurse Practitioners in Clarksville (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 3.45%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$96,420 | Actual |
| 2020 | $98,390 | Actual |
| 2021 | $97,920 | Actual |
| 2022 | $100,220 | Actual |
| 2023 | $103,480 | Actual |
| 2024 | $101,650 | Actual |
| 2025 | $115,160 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$119,133 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$123,243 | Projected |
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Clarksville metropolitan area, the median nurse practitioner salary grew 19.4% from $96,420 (2019) to $115,160 (2025). At a 3.45%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$123,243 by 2027 — a total increase of $26,823 (27.82%) from 2019.
Note: Historical values (2019–2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Clarksville met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026–2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 3.45%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data. Nurse Practitioner Job Market in Clarksville
The local job market in Clarksville employs around 300 nurse practitioners, offering a solid base of opportunities for advanced practice professionals. With a cost-of-living index of 90.947, many find that their take-home pay stretches further than in more expensive urban settings, enhancing their purchasing power. Among local employers, outpatient clinics and specialty practices typically offer higher compensation compared to primary care offices and urgent care facilities. The variation in pay stems from factors like the specialized focus of certain roles, including psychiatric mental health nurse practitioners (PMHNPs) who often command higher salaries, and the financial implications tied to collaboration agreements in restricted-practice environments. To maximize earnings, nurse practitioners in Clarksville are advised to pursue certifications aligned with high-demand specialties and explore opportunities in telehealth, which can provide lucrative side income without the overhead of traditional practice settings.
